Key DifferencesBattery life varies between the two (35 / 40 / 60 Hours vs 50 Hours), which affects how long you can use them on a single charge. There is a noticeable difference in weight (268 Gm vs 50 Gm), which may affect comfort during extended use. Soundcore Life Q20 and Tribit FlyBuds C1 offer different noise cancellation capabilities (Hybrid ANC vs CVC), which can impact how effectively they block external noise. Impedance levels vary (16 Ohm vs NA), which can affect compatibility and audio output when used with different devices. Overall, both headphones are feature-rich and cater to users looking for a combination of sound quality, comfort, and wireless convenience. The driver size differs between the two (40 X 2 mm vs 6 mm), which can influence sound depth, bass response, and overall audio clarity. The frequency response differs (16 Hz - 40000 Hz vs 20 Hz - 48000 Hz), which can influence how well the headphones reproduce lows, mids, and highs. Soundcore Life Q20 uses Bluetooth 5.0 while Tribit FlyBuds C1 supports Bluetooth 5.2, which can impact connectivity stability and efficiency. Soundcore Life Q20 and Tribit FlyBuds C1 are well-known options in the wireless headphone segment, offering a balance of audio quality, battery performance, and smart features. Verdict: Both headphones offer strong performance, and the right choice depends on your priorities such as battery life, comfort, and noise cancellation. Top Differences
